Bihar Makes Cricket History with Record-Breaking Score

In a remarkable achievement, Bihar has etched its name in cricket history by posting the highest team total ever recorded in List A cricket. During their Vijay Hazare Trophy (VHT) 2025-26 Plate League match against Andhra Pradesh on Wednesday, Bihar scored an astonishing 574 runs for the loss of 6 wickets in 50 overs. This score eclipsed the previous record of 506 runs for 2 wickets set by Tamil Nadu against Arunachal Pradesh in Bengaluru back in 2022.


Moreover, Bihar has now become the first team to surpass the 550-run mark in List A cricket. They are only the second team, following Tamil Nadu, to achieve a total of 500 runs in this format, as reported by ESPNcricinfo.
